The Role:
Do you enjoy a hands-on challenge? On the night shift, you’ll ensure train interiors are clean, fresh, and ready for the next day’s services. Tasks include hoovering, mopping, sanitizing, and deep cleaning. This role is physically demanding and requires you to be active throughout your shift.

Working Hours:
You’ll work night shifts on a rotating 12-week schedule, including weekdays and weekends.
8 weeks: 10:00 PM – 6:00 AM
4 weeks: 8:30 PM – 4:30 AM
Average weekly hours: 35
Rate of Pay:
Standard hours (35 hours/week): £15.19 p/h
Overtime (hour 36+): £18.22 p/h
Rest Day Working: £19.74 p/h
Sunday Shifts: £22.02 p/h
After 12 weeks: Pay increase as part of Agency Worker Rights
Training and PPE: Fully provided
Opportunity for a permanent role after a 6-month contract
